@zimpligital/medusa-plugin-auth-otp
Version:
A starter for Medusa plugins.
16 lines • 1.6 kB
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.updatePendingRequestStep = void 0;
const workflows_sdk_1 = require("@medusajs/framework/workflows-sdk");
const auth_otp_1 = require("../../../modules/auth-otp");
exports.updatePendingRequestStep = (0, workflows_sdk_1.createStep)("update-pending-request-step", async ({ id }, { container }) => {
const authOTPService = container.resolve(auth_otp_1.AUTH_OTP_MODULE_SERVICE);
const expiredAt = await authOTPService.getExpiredAt();
const updated = await authOTPService.updateOtpRequests({
id,
status: "pending",
expired_at: expiredAt,
});
return new workflows_sdk_1.StepResponse(updated);
});
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oidXBkYXRlLXBlbmRpbmctcmVxdWVzdC1zdGVwLmpzIiwic291cmNlUm9vdCI6IiIsInNvdXJjZXMiOlsiLi4vLi4vLi4vLi4vLi4vLi4vc3JjL3dvcmtmbG93cy9yZXF1ZXN0LW90cC13b3JrZmxvdy9zdGVwcy91cGRhdGUtcGVuZGluZy1yZXF1ZXN0LXN0ZXAudHMiXSwibmFtZXMiOltdLCJtYXBwaW5ncyI6Ijs7O0FBQUEscUVBQTZFO0FBRTdFLHdEQUFvRTtBQUV2RCxRQUFBLHdCQUF3QixHQUFHLElBQUEsMEJBQVUsRUFDakQsNkJBQTZCLEVBQzdCLEtBQUssRUFBRSxFQUFFLEVBQUUsRUFBa0IsRUFBRSxFQUFFLFNBQVMsRUFBRSxFQUFFLEVBQUU7SUFDL0MsTUFBTSxjQUFjLEdBQXlCLFNBQVMsQ0FBQyxPQUFPLENBQzdELGtDQUF1QixDQUN2QixDQUFDO0lBRUYsTUFBTSxTQUFTLEdBQUcsTUFBTSxjQUFjLENBQUMsWUFBWSxFQUFFLENBQUM7SUFDdEQsTUFBTSxPQUFPLEdBQUcsTUFBTSxjQUFjLENBQUMsaUJBQWlCLENBQUM7UUFDdEQsRUFBRTtRQUNGLE1BQU0sRUFBRSxTQUFTO1FBQ2pCLFVBQVUsRUFBRSxTQUFTO0tBQ3JCLENBQUMsQ0FBQztJQUVILE9BQU8sSUFBSSw0QkFBWSxDQUFDLE9BQU8sQ0FBQyxDQUFDO0FBQ2xDLENBQUMsQ0FDRCxDQUFDIn0=